APPLICATION OF ARSENIC AROMATIC COMPOUNDS IN MODELING OF ARSENIC-CONTAINING WATERS

Journal Title: Молодий вчений - Year 2017, Vol 9, Issue 49

Abstract

Arsenic aromatic compounds, which are present in reservoirs, can have both natural and anthropogenic origin. According to the literature data, atomic emission spectroscopy with inductively coupled plasma, high performance liquid chromatography, mass spectrometry with inductively coupled plasma are the main methods of determining for these substances in the aquatic phase. But these methods are very expensive and require complicated maintenance of high-priced equipment. Replacing of colorless arsonyl compounds on C16H13N2O11S2As (5-hydroxy-3-[[2-[hydroxy(oxido)arsoryl]phenyl]hydrazinylidene]-4-oxonaphthalene-2,7-disulfonate) can significantly simplify the research. It has been established experimentally that the photometric determination of concentrations (wavelength of 500 nm) in the range of 0.2-24.0 mg/l gives precise results, and, consequently, the application of C16H13N2O11S2As is appropriate.
